      Hi  !

      This comparison chart shows the differences between LTI 1.3, LTI 1.1 and Plagiarism Framework.

      Between LTI 1.3 and Plagiarism Framework, there are a few features which are mutually exclusive.

      One of the main things that is not available in LTI 1.3 is the fact that the submissions are not available in Canvas SpeedGrader. If your instructors want to use SpeedGrader, then they have to create the assignment using Plagiarism Framework. (Which is why both these integrations should be enabled in your Canvas instance.)

      But all the latest and greatest features are in LTI 1.3. Plagiarism Framework is frozen in time.

      We are currently on LTI 1.1, so in order to have some of the functionality our instructors are used to, we are going to have to use enable LTI 1.3 and Plagiarism Framework integrations.

      And instructors will have to choose one or the other when setting up their assignments.
